How they compare
Rwanda currently reports 8.6 % change on previous year against 4.38 % change on previous year in Low income, a difference of 4.22 % change on previous year.
That makes Rwanda's figure about 2.0 times Low income's.
The two have swapped places 8 times across 14 shared years of data; in 2012 it was Rwanda ahead.
Low income ranks 12th and Rwanda ranks 13th of 41 groups.
Rwanda has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
The year-on-year percentage change in Gross national expenditure (constant 2015 US$). Computed from consecutive annual observations; years either side of a gap are skipped rather than bridged.
